What Is an Online Meeting Site?
An online meeting site is a website or application that allows users to host virtual meetings with other people. It typically offers features such as video conferencing, screen sharing, file sharing, and chat. Popular online meeting sites include Zoom, GoToMeeting, Webex, and Microsoft Teams.
Online meetings are typically free or much cheaper than traditional in-person meetings. Participants can join from any device, including laptops, tablets, and smartphones. They can also share documents, whiteboards, and other tools to collaborate more effectively on projects.

Encourage Engagement
Online meetings can be a great way to keep remote teams connected, but they can also be boring if not managed properly. To keep everyone engaged during meetings, try using interactive tools like polls or whiteboards. You can also encourage participation by asking open-ended questions or having people take turns leading discussions. By making meetings engaging and interactive, you can ensure that everyone is involved and productive.
